The United States authorities, by way of the U.S. Company for Worldwide Improvement (USAID), has introduced a strategic partnership with Ascend Studios, a creative-industry organisation offering capability constructing, mentorship, social, instructional, and financial empowerment to ladies and youth to be able to propel Nigeria’s artistic sector.
This partnership will catalyse extra funding to strengthen Nigeria’s burgeoning Nollywood {industry} with extra companions together with Paramount Nigeria, Enterprise Backyard Group, and famend music govt Ralph Simon.
The Africa Inventive Blueprint, will strengthen Nigerian youth with the abilities and sources wanted to compete within the artistic {industry} and in addition elevate Nigerian creatives to the worldwide stage.
Remarking on the partnership, USAID Nigeria Mission Director, Melissa Jones mentioned: “The U.S. authorities is raring to reinforce Nigeria’s capability as a number one participant within the artistic economic system and encourage world partnerships. This partnership will create a stream of high-quality, commercially viable content material that may compete on the world stage.”
Talking on the movie {industry} she mentioned: “Whereas Nigeria’s movie {industry} has achieved world recognition, it faces structural challenges that hinder its full financial and artistic potential. Key areas for enchancment embody increasing movie distribution channels, enhancing manufacturing high quality by way of superior tools, creating stronger screenwriting and story improvement practices, and reinforcing mental property protections. Addressing these gaps would allow the artistic sector to seize a broader viewers and help extra sustainable income streams for filmmakers.
To handle these challenges, USAID teamed up with the Nigerian and American personal sectors to launch the Africa Inventive Blueprint. On the core of the collective $3.5 million funding, the Africa Inventive Blueprint will present intensive coaching expertise in TV manufacturing to three,500 Nigerian youth, and develop a talented TV workforce of at the least 200 youth to create a high-quality, music-infused 13-episode TV drama. The TV drama will likely be a robust medium to convey social messages, promote optimistic change, and foster inclusive development and equitable alternative in Nigeria. The coaching will happen throughout six Nigerian cities: Lagos, Abuja, Enugu, Kano, Benin, and Asaba, making certain wide-reaching entry to this distinctive improvement alternative.”
